Hardware Systems Administrator

Booz Allen HamiltonChantilly, VA
Onsite

About The Position

The Hardware Systems Administrator role focuses on improving the technology that supports the Mission Partner. This position requires a system administrator with deep expertise in Linux systems, container orchestration using tools like Kubernetes, and automation with tools like Ansible. The ideal candidate will effectively bridge the gap between complex technical execution and client-facing communication. As a system administrator, you will manage and optimize infrastructure, taking responsibility for the architecture, security, and performance of systems and containerized environments. You will provide customers with insights into their network through monitoring and performance management. Your expertise will be crucial in identifying problem areas and opportunities for improvement within a mission-critical network. You will help the team better understand the network by translating metrics into actionable information and explaining their significance. This role offers an opportunity to expand your skill set into areas such as automation logic, cluster management, workload management, and CI/CD integration. The team emphasizes growth, so you will share your expertise through leadership and mentoring, assisting the team in overcoming challenges and developing new methodologies. As a system administration leader, you will identify new opportunities to modernize the network to help clients achieve their goals. Requirements

  • 7+ years of experience in Linux administration
  • Experience with automation tools such as Ansible or Terraform
  • Experience with containers such as Docker, Kubernetes, or Podman
  • Experience with SELinux and FA policy d, STIG hardening, Identity Management (IdM), LDAP, and managing secrets and certificates
  • Knowledge of IT networking and security concepts
  • Ability to translate complex technical requirements into solutions for clients and engineers
  • TS/SCI clearance with a polygraph
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a STEM field
  • DoD 8140 Certification

Nice To Haves

  • Experience in administration of RHEL
  • Experience deploying and managing production Kubernetes clusters such as OpenShift, EKS, or RKE
  • Experience with Helm charts, Kustomize, and managing persistent container storage interface (CSI) and container networking interface (CNI)
  • Experience integrating IaC and Ansible into pipelines such as GitLab CI, Jenkins, or GitHub Actions
  • Knowledge of IP tables and NFTables, DNS, load balancing, HAProxy, Nginx, and namespace
  • Ability to use troubleshooting tools such as ss, netstat, tcpdump, traceroute, and ping to isolate network problems
  • Ability to conduct performance tuning, kernel patching, and debugging as well as optimizing Linux kernels for container workloads such as tweaking sysctl for K8s
  • Master’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a STEM field
  • Red Hat Certified Engineer (RHCE) or Linux Foundation Certified Engineer (LFCE) Certification
